Top Restaurants Offering Delivery & Takeout in Holden, Massachusetts - November, 2024

La Miette La Mai Thai Bistro

278 Main St
Northborough, Massachusetts
Open : 11:30 AM - 9:30 PM

McDonald's

72 Auburn St
Auburn, Massachusetts
Open : 5:30 AM - 11:00 PM

Subway

68-70 Auburn St
Auburn, Massachusetts
Open : 8:30 AM - 8:30 PM

Burger King

865 Grafton St
Worcester, Massachusetts
Open : 7:00 AM - 11:00 PM

El Buen Sabor Restaurant

59 Chandler St
Worcester, Massachusetts
Open : 9:00 AM - 6:00 PM

Wendy's

560 SW Cutoff
Worcester, Massachusetts
Open : 6:30 AM - 1:00 AM

Honey Dew Donuts

851 Grafton St
Worcester, Massachusetts
Open : 4:00 AM - 7:00 PM

Dunkin'

Medical Center
Worcester, Massachusetts
Open : 5:00 AM - 10:00 PM

Friendly's

697 Southbridge St
Auburn, Massachusetts
Open : 11:00 AM - 10:00 PM

Pizzeria Delight

522 Cambridge St
Worcester, Massachusetts
Open : 10:30 AM - 11:00 PM

Papa Gino's

459 Southbridge St
Auburn, Massachusetts
Open : 10:30 AM - 10:00 PM

Lucky House

165 High St
Clinton, Massachusetts
Open : 11:00 AM - 10:30 PM

Pizza Hut

349 Grafton St
Worcester, Massachusetts
Open : 10:30 AM - 12:00 AM

Subway

197 W Boylston St #2
West Boylston, Massachusetts
Open : 9:00 AM - 9:00 PM

Horse Shoe Pub

29 South St
Hudson, Massachusetts
Open : 11:30 AM - 9:00 PM